Agoda seems very popular in this region but not much is Euro and US. In US i often use Hotwire or Priceline where they also have secret hotel which is much cheaper. Hotwire is also my favorite to get cheaper car rentals.
Was informed Booking.com is under same organisation with Agoda. I found Agoda is always cheaper, booking.com is a trap where they didn't put taxes. At 5 star hotels is normally cheaper if book direct if long stay.
How about you guys.
